Interpretation leads to an understanding of the degree or severity of abnormalities, whether the abnormalities are acute or chronic, … WebAn arterial line should be used for obtaining ABGs in the patient whose condition requires multiple testing. A peripheral puncture is performed if multiple blood draws aren't necessary. Drawing an ABG sample is similar to drawing a venous blood sample. Follow your facility's policy and procedure. First, waste a couple ml's of … WebAug 8, 2014 · 10-15 minutes of drawing; iced samples should be analyzed within 1 hour.' The PaO2 of samples drawn from subjects with elevated white cell counts may decrease very rapidly. WebBlood Sampling System A closed, needlefree in-line blood sampling system that reduces blood waste, while minimizing the risk of IV line contamination and the transmission of infectious disease. Two needlefree access options prevent exposure to infectious diseases. Reduces blood waste because the clearing volume can be reinfused.
